About Us
Festive Road is a carnival arts company run by five professional artists. We are a Community Interest Company which means we are a not for profit organisation.We specialise in providing summer and winter carnival workshops, events and performances.
We
- create spectacular giant figures to glide in street processions.
- make costumes for individuals and groups.
- organise and lead workshops in the community.
- project-manage processional events.
- create street/ theatrical performances.
- provide training in carnival arts to the community.

Dhol Drumming Group
Last year we set up Milton Keynes' first Dhol Drumming Band MK Dhol. The band perform at Festive Road's parades and festivals across the city and are available for bookings. For more information click the MKDhol link.

Starlight Samba Band
Festive Road supported Water Eaton Church from Bletchley to form a samba band. Festive Road secured funding to pay for drums and samba instruction from world class samba Instructor Damian Manning. We also held workshops to make costumes. The aim of the band is to be inclusive with people of all ages and ability and has 27 members, 13 are under 25 and 5 members have special needs.
